About
BeeLevel is a product of Aurion Creative, a South African software studio. It exists because enterprise and supplier development, one of the most consequential parts of B-BBEE, is usually administered in the least consequential tools: spreadsheets in three versions, shared drives nobody trusts, and email threads that become the audit trail by accident.
The cost of that chaos lands twice. It lands on transformation teams every verification season, reconstructing a year of work under deadline. And it lands on beneficiary SMEs, who get chased for the same certificate three times by three different people because nobody can see it was already sent.
BeeLevel is the boring, load-bearing fix: one system of record where beneficiaries, documents, spend and evidence live together, kept in order as the year happens rather than assembled in a panic at the end of it.
B-BBEE status is decided by SANAS-accredited verification agencies, not by software. BeeLevel presents records and evidence; it never computes points, levels or pass/fail outcomes. That line is structural, not cosmetic.
Approved financial records are immutable, corrections are visible reversals, and every action lands in an append-only audit log. A system of record that can be quietly rewritten is not a system of record.
SMEs are the point of ESD, not its paperwork burden. They get their own portal, their preferred contact channel is honoured, and personal information is collected minimally and shown only to the people whose job needs it.
